Elizabeth George has long been a master in mystery, and the mystery here is an excellent one, with a nice twist. One peeve, and it's a small one - Ms. George doesn't mind using similar names. We've got a Carol and Caroline, a Lynley, Lynn, and Lilie (sorry if I've misspelled - I did the audio version), so if you let your mind wander in the beginning, it's easy to get confused about which character is which. Won't stop me wanting to hear this one again, though.
